A Person-Oriented Approach: Methods for Today and Methods for Tomorrow
Bergman, Lars R.; El-Khouri, Bassam M.
New Directions for Child and Adolescent Development, n101 p25-38 Fall 2003
Methodological implications of a person-oriented, holistic-interactionistic perspective in research on individual development are outlined, desirable properties of a mathematical model of a phenomenon are discussed, and selected methods for carrying out person-oriented research are briefly overviewed. These methods are: (1) the classificatory approach for approximately continuous variables; and (2) studying dynamical systems. The article also discusses issues that are important for the appropriate implementation of the person-oriented approach, including the match of problem and method and obtaining classifications using cluster analysis-based methods.
